Shipping containers can be found in numerous types, each developed for particular functions. Comprehending these can help purchasers select the ideal container for their requirements.
Typical Types of Shipping Containers:
Standard Containers: These are the most often used containers, typically measured at 20 and 40 feet in length. Ideal for general shipping needs.

Refrigerated Containers (Reefers): Designed to bring temperature-sensitive items, such as perishable food products.

Open-Top Containers: Ideal for carrying extra-large cargo that can not fit through standard container doors.

Flat-Rack Containers: Used for heavy devices and products that do not require complete enclosure.

High Cube Containers: Taller than basic containers, supplying additional vertical space for cargo.

Tanks: Specifically designed to transport liquid products safely.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)1. What is the typical price of a shipping container?
The typical cost of a used basic shipping container usually varies between ₤ 2,000 and ₤ 5,000, depending upon the condition and type. New containers can cost substantially more.
2. How long do shipping containers last?
With correct upkeep, Shipping Container Cost containers can last 25 years or more. Nevertheless, their lifespan can vary based on use and ecological conditions.
